My son is 40 days old. After delivery my wife had good supply of milk and but the baby was not latching properly so the milk supply has reduced. Now my baby is nursing on her aunt and mother both. Does it cause any problems if a baby is getting milk from two womens? Also doctor has suggested lactera for my wife to increase milk production. How long can one take lactera?

A. Hello dear parent! Try as much to exclusively breastfeed your well on demand. Latch the baby well onto the breast and make a good skin contact with your baby while breastfeeding to stimulate breastmilk supply. Consult a lactation expert for advice.
